温馨提示×

温馨提示×

您好,登录后才能下订单哦!

密码登录×
登录注册×
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》

如何提高R语言的数据清洗效率

发布时间:2024-12-06 22:59:58 来源:亿速云 阅读:81 作者:小樊 栏目:编程语言

提高R语言的数据清洗效率可以通过以下方法实现:

  • 使用高效的包:安装并加载如tidyversejanitorlubridate等包,这些包集成了多种数据清洗和转换的函数,可以显著提高清洗效率。
  • 利用向量化操作:R语言支持向量化操作,这使得数据清洗和分析的操作更加高效。通过一次性对向量进行操作,可以避免使用循环,从而提高处理速度。
  • 避免不必要的复制:在数据清洗过程中,尽量避免不必要的复制操作,以减少内存消耗和提高运算速度。
  • 使用适当的数据结构:选择合适的数据结构,如数据框(data.frame),可以方便地进行数据清洗操作。数据框是R语言中最常用的数据结构,适合于大多数数据清洗任务。
  • 利用并行计算:当处理大规模数据集时,可以考虑使用并行计算来加速数据清洗过程。R语言提供了多种并行计算的包,如parallelforeach,可以有效地利用多核处理器提高计算速度。

通过上述方法,可以显著提高R语言数据清洗的效率,使数据清洗过程更加高效和便捷。

向AI问一下细节

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

AI